## Authentication

The Driftlock password reset revamp moved token issuance to the Quillgate service. Plugins no longer mint reset tokens locally. Request tokens via `POST /reset/issue`; responses expire in 15 minutes. All calls require the Quillgate plugin credential in the `X-Plugin-Auth` header. The sandbox key is provided below.

gateway credential: zpat15_lMLOSdhT94y0U3l

## Changelog — AddrGlide Widget 4.2.0

Changed defaults for the address autocomplete widget. Debounce now starts at 250ms instead of 100ms, minimum query length rises to three characters, and fuzzy matching is enabled out of the box. These reduce backend load noticeably in the Torvane staging runs. Release manager: please confirm downstream teams have acknowledged the new defaults, which are recorded in full below.

service settings:
PRAIX_LOG_LEVEL=error
PRAIX_METRICS_HOST=metrics.praix.qorvelcorp.corp
PRAIX_POOL_SIZE=16

**Catalogue Import — Security Considerations.** The Thornquill import pipeline ingests MARC-like records from partner branches into the Lanternfold catalogue. All payloads are parsed in a sandboxed worker with no network egress; malformed records are quarantined rather than dropped, so reviewers can inspect them. Rate limits and parser depth caps are the primary defenses against decompression bombs and pathological nesting. For review purposes, the enforced limits are fixed at build time and are reproduced below.

tuning table, faduf-baduf:
PRIORITIES = {
    "ulavan": 191,
    "silys": 750,
    "goriel": 238,
    "kelmir": 66,
    "wendor": 432,
}

Handover for new starters covering the Quillbrook prototype workshop: machines are powered down nightly, consumables are logged in the blue binder, and safety glasses live by the door. Inductions run Tuesdays with Marta. Until your badge is provisioned, use the keypad on the workshop door; the current code is below.

badge for fawip-kafof: bdg-TMT-0